Abstract :
In this paper, the approximate solution of the differential system modeling HIV infection of CD4+ T cells is
obtained by a reliable algorithm based on an adaptation of the standard variational iteration method (VIM), which
is called the multi-stage variational iteration method(MSVIM). A comparison between MSVIM and the fourthorder
Runge-Kutta method (RK4-method) reveal that the proposed technique is a promising tool to solve the
considered problem.
